"""Tests for optional self-hosted Sentry observability (#606). Covers the pure module (config, redaction, event/check-in builders) and the runtime capture paths using a fake ``sentry_sdk``, so nothing ever touches the network. Critically proves the feature is a no-op when disabled or DSN-less (acceptance criterion 1) and that secrets/paths/session-state are never sent (criterion 5). """ import sys import contextlib from pathlib import Path import pytest sys.path.insert(0, str(Path(__file__).resolve().parent.parent)) import sentry_observability as so # noqa: E402 # ── Fake SDK ──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────── class _FakeScope: def __init__(self): self.tags = {} self.extras = {} def set_tag(self, k, v): self.tags[k] = v def set_extra(self, k, v): self.extras[k] = v class FakeSentrySDK: """Minimal stand-in exposing the SDK surface sentry_observability uses.""" def __init__(self): self.init_kwargs = None self.events = [] self.exceptions = [] self.checkins = [] self.last_scope = None def init(self, **kwargs): self.init_kwargs = kwargs def capture_event(self, event): self.events.append(event) def capture_exception(self, exc): self.exceptions.append(exc) def capture_checkin(self, **payload): self.checkins.append(payload) @contextlib.contextmanager def push_scope(self): self.last_scope = _FakeScope() yield self.last_scope @pytest.fixture(autouse=True) def _reset_state(): """Isolate module init state between tests.""" so.reset_for_tests() yield so.reset_for_tests() @pytest.fixture def fake_sdk(monkeypatch): sdk = FakeSentrySDK() monkeypatch.setattr(so, "sentry_sdk", sdk) return sdk #
